Next, to convert the mixed number 1 + 6/10 into a single fraction, we need to find a common denominator between the whole number and the fractional part. In this case, the common denominator is 10, as both the whole number 1 and the fraction 6/10 are based on tenths.

To combine the whole number 1 and the fraction 6/10 into a single fraction, we can multiply the whole number by the common denominator and add it to the numerator of the fraction. This gives us a new numerator of 16 (1 x 10 + 6), which we can then write over the common denominator of 10 to get the fraction 16/10.

At this point, we have successfully converted the decimal number 1.6 into the fraction 16/10. However, to simplify this fraction and express it in its lowest terms, we need to divide both the numerator and the denominator by their greatest common divisor, which in this case is 2.

By dividing the numerator 1.6 as a Fraction and the denominator 10 by 2, we get the simplified fraction 8/5. Therefore, the decimal number 1.6 can be precisely converted into the rational fractional form of 8/5.

In summary, converting the decimal number 1.6 into its rational fractional form involves breaking down the decimal into its whole number and fractional components, finding a common denominator, combining the whole number and fraction into a single fraction, and simplifying the fraction to its lowest terms. The process requires careful attention to precision and accuracy to ensure that the final result is a correct and simplified fraction.
